A140298 a(0)=1; a(3n+1) = a(3n)+1, a(3n+2) = a(3n+1) + a(3n) (=3*A000244), a(3n+3) = a(3n+2) + a(3n) (=A003462(n+2)). 3
1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 9, 13, 14, 27, 40, 41, 81, 121, 122, 243, 364, 365, 729, 1093, 1094, 2187, 3280, 3281, 6561, 9841, 9842, 19683, 29524, 29525, 59049, 88573, 88574, 177147, 265720, 265721, 531441, 797161, 797162, 1594323, 2391484, 2391485, 4782969, 7174453, 7174454 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)

FORMULA
From R. J. Mathar, Jan 17 2009: (Start)
G.f.: (1 + 3*x + 6*x^2 + 6*x^3 + 3*x^4)/((1 + x + x^2)*(1 - 3*x^3)).
a(n) = -a(n-1) - a(n-2) + 3*a(n-3) + 3*a(n-4) + 3*a(n-5).
a(n) = (3*b(n)-A049347(n))/2 where b(n)=1,1,2,3,3,6,9,9,18,27,27,54,.. = 3*b(n-3).
(End)
PROG
(PARI) Vec((1+3*x+6*x^2+6*x^3+3*x^4)/((1+x+x^2)*(1-3*x^3))+O(x^99)) \\ Charles R Greathouse IV, Jun 20 2011
